Module: statt/av/adresse/nummern/tableEditor

Dieses Modul definiert die Klasse nummerTableEditor

Author:
  • sdw.systems
Source:
See:
  • module:sdw/inline/editorMetadata
  • module:sdw/inline/editormanager

Extends

Requires

Members

moduleName

Properties:
Name Type Description
moduleName String

Name des Moduls aus lokaler Konstante

Source:

Methods

callbackOnChange()

Callback, wird von this.fsNummernkreis beim onChange-Event aufgerufen und steuert die diasbled-Eigenschaft der Controls in der AddTemplateRow. Wird hier überschrieben um das Control in Spalte 1 zu disablen falls der Nummernkreis nicht manuell ist. Vorher aber die Implementierung der Basisklasse aufrufen.

Source:

createCellControl(row, cal, metadataItemCol, beforeImageItem) → {Object}

Überschreibt die Implementierung der Basisklasse und gibt für die 1. Spalte die Implementierung der Basisklasse zurück. Rest sind eine ValidationTextBox für die optional editierbare Nummer und eine Textare.

Parameters:
Name Type Description
row Number

Die Zeilennummer der Zelle

cal Number

Die Spaltennummer der Zelle

metadataItemCol Object

Ein Zeiger auf das zutreffende Col-Objekt der EditorMetadaten

beforeImageItem Object

Ein Zeiger auf das relevante Objekt des beforeImages, das der initiale Wert des Editors darstellt.

Source:
Returns:

Ein dijit/form/control-Objekt

Type
Object